商城首页欢迎来到中国正版软件门户

最新文章

  • PHP error_reporting 与 ini_set 区别详解 正版软件
    PHP error_reporting 与 ini_set 区别详解
    要选择使用error_reporting还是ini_set,需明确需求。若仅设置错误报告级别,应使用error_reporting,如error_reporting(E_WARNING|E_ERROR);若需动态修改其他配置,则用ini_set,如ini_set('display_errors','Off');二者区别在于,error_reporting作用于当前脚本,而ini_set修改的配置可能影响全局;使用ini_set修改error_reporting存在风险,可能降低代码可读性,并可能被服务器限
    123天前 ini_set 0
  • C++如何安全使用std::variant\_类型安全应用 正版软件
    C++如何安全使用std::variant\_类型安全应用
    std::variant是C++17引入的类型安全联合体,可存储多种类型之一并记录当前激活类型,避免未定义行为。通过std::get_if安全获取值或std::visit结合lambda实现类型安全的泛型访问,适用于配置解析、表达式求值、多类型返回等场景,提升代码安全性与可维护性。
    123天前 C++类型安全 0
  • C++解析CSV文件技巧分享 正版软件
    C++解析CSV文件技巧分享
    答案:使用C++标准库解析CSV需处理引号内逗号与转义,通过逐字符判断引号状态实现准确分割。
    123天前 CSV解析 C++文件处理 0
  • Java中使用Formatter.format格式化字符串实践 正版软件
    Java中使用Formatter.format格式化字符串实践
    Formatter类用于格式化数据,通过format()方法结合格式说明符(如%s、%d)生成结构化文本,支持对齐、填充等控制,并可与StringBuilder结合提升性能。
    123天前 Java 0
  • XAMPP MySQL意外关闭解决方法 正版软件
    XAMPP MySQL意外关闭解决方法
    本教程针对XAMPP中MySQL服务意外关闭问题,详细阐述了其常见原因,如端口冲突或数据文件损坏。文章提供了一套实用的解决方案,通过分析错误日志定位问题,并指导用户如何安全地重建MySQL数据目录,同时迁移现有数据库,以确保MySQL服务能够稳定启动并正常运行。
    123天前 0
  • C# is与as操作符区别及使用技巧 正版软件
    C# is与as操作符区别及使用技巧
    <p>is仅判断类型并返回布尔值,不执行转换;as尝试安全转换,失败返回null且只检查一次类型。C#7.0+支持is模式匹配(如if(objisstringstr))实现判断与赋值一体化。</p>
    123天前 类型转换 C# 0
  • Java中Collections.sort排序技巧 正版软件
    Java中Collections.sort排序技巧
    Collections.sort()用于对List排序,需元素实现Comparable或传入Comparator;支持字符串和自定义对象排序,可结合Comparator实现多种排序方式,使用时注意避免null元素并选择高效的数据结构。
    123天前 Java 0
  • PHP制作动态网页步骤详解 正版软件
    PHP制作动态网页步骤详解
    需配置本地PHP环境(如XAMPP)、创建.php文件嵌入HTML与PHP代码、连接MySQL数据库查询数据、处理GET/POST表单提交、用include/require模块化引入页眉页脚。
    123天前 0
  • 正则表达式:^\d+[\+\-\*\/]\d+$  说明:  ^ 表示字符串开始  \d+ 匹配一个或多个数字  [\+\-\*\/] 匹配加、减、乘、除中的任 正版软件
    正则表达式:^\d+[\+\-\*\/]\d+$ 说明: ^ 表示字符串开始 \d+ 匹配一个或多个数字 [\+\-\*\/] 匹配加、减、乘、除中的任
    本文将指导读者如何使用正则表达式从字符串中精确提取数学表达式,确保这些表达式不与任何字母字符或算术符号相邻。我们将通过构建一个结合负向先行断言和负向后行断言的正则表达式模式,有效地隔离并匹配符合条件的数学表达式,并提供Python示例代码进行演示。
    123天前 0
  • C++如何删除文件?标准库方法详解 正版软件
    C++如何删除文件?标准库方法详解
    答案是使用std::filesystem::remove删除文件。从C++17起,推荐使用<filesystem>中的std::filesystem::remove函数跨平台删除文件,它在文件存在且删除成功时返回true,不存在则返回false但不抛异常,需用try-catch处理权限等错误;对于旧版本C++,可使用<cstdio>中的std::remove,返回0表示成功,但错误处理能力弱,无法区分文件不存在与权限问题,建议优先采用std::filesystem::remove。
    123天前 0